Last week, the College Football Playoff committee released its first rankings for the 2025 season. Miami was ranked No. 18. CFP Committee chair Mack Rhodes cited Miami’s inconsistencies as a factor. However, Notre Dame earned the No. 10 spot. And that’s the crux of the issue, for which the Canes are nursing a grudge.
The CFP committee released the list on November 4, considering games until week 10. Post week 10, both Miami and Notre Dame were 6-2, and yet the difference in the rankings is glaring. On top of that, the Canes beat the Irish in a 27-24 contest during the season opener at Hard Rock Stadium. But that win wasn’t factored into the rankings. What made Miami fans even more upset was a report by ESPN reporter Kris Budden.
